RESEARCH | Dylan Duerre, Andrea Galmozzi et al. (UW–Madison): Inhibition of haem synthesis is shown to lead to the accumulation of branched-chain amino acids in the brown adipose tissue of mice, which impairs #thermogenesis 🐭🌡️ nature.com/articles/s4225…

New paper from Jakub Bunk and Mina Ersin in our lab: CKB is the key creatine kinase driving UCP1-independent #thermogenesis in beige fat via the futile creatine cycle (FCC). doi.org/10.1016/j.molm… Rosalind & Morris Goodman Cancer Institute McGill Biochemistry Molecular Metabolism

Type 2 diabetes is often considered a protein misfolding disease. But where are these toxic proteins found? 🤔 🚨In new work out today in Nature Metabolism, we show that mitochondrial protein misfolding (yes mitos🤯) leads to beta cell damage in T2D. 🚨 nature.com/articles/s4225… 1/n
